Growing up I had a dad who was manic depressive and diagnosed as bipolar. As a family we appeared relatively normal but what was going on behind closed doors was anything but normal. We were dealing with tons of anxiety, depression and trust issues.

So how did I shield myself growing up and well into my 20's… I ate sugar and lots of it.

And with all that was going on I remember soothing myself with ice cream and rows of Oreos!

Maybe you can relate on some level?

I do believe I will still always be in recovery when I eat sugar…who can seriously stop after eating just one Oreo.. COME ON!
